Teeling launches single malt whiskey in the US

The Teeling Whiskey Company is expanding its presence overseas with the launch of its no-age-statement single malt Irish whiskey in the US.

Teeling Single Malt Irish Whiskey is now available in the US

The Irish whiskey producer first unveiled its single malt variant in October last year, completing its core range of NAS expressions.

Teeling Single Malt consists of malt whiskey aged up to 23 years old that has been matured in five different wine casks including Sherry, Port, Madeira, white Burgundy and Cabernet Sauvignon, and has been non-chill-filtered.

The group claims the combination of casks creates a “vibrant and balanced” flavour of dried fruit, citrus, vanilla, spice and cloves.

“We are delighted to be able to release another expression of Teeling whiskey that helps expand consumer choice and challenge existing perceptions of Irish whiskey,” said Jack Teeling, founder of the Teeling Whiskey Company.

“Our new Teeling Single Malt proves Irish whiskey can have big bold flavours that appeal to Single Malt drinkers without losing its distinctive Irish identity.”

The Teeling premium range also includes Small Batch Blended Irish Whiskey and Single Grain Irish Whiskey, which was launched in the US in February this year.

In January 2015, the group signed a US distribution deal with Infinium Spirits.

Teeling officially opened the doors of its new €10 million Irish whiskey distillery in Dublin this summer, marking the first time an Irish whiskey distillery had been built in the city in 125 years.

As such the current range of Teeling whiskeys are created using third party-sourced liquid.
